Understanding APR Tuning Stages

APR offers a range of tuning options for various vehicles, typically categorized into stages. Each stage represents a different level of performance enhancement, with Stage 1 being the most basic and Stage 2 offering more advanced modifications.

Stage 1 Modifications

APR Stage 1 tuning primarily focuses on software modifications. This stage is designed to optimize the vehicle’s existing performance without requiring significant hardware changes.

  • Improved throttle response
  • Increased horsepower and torque
  • Better fuel efficiency

Stage 2 Modifications

APR Stage 2 tuning takes performance to the next level by incorporating hardware upgrades alongside the software tuning. This stage typically requires additional modifications to fully realize the potential gains.

  • Upgraded exhaust system
  • High-flow intake
  • Enhanced intercooler

Measuring Power Gains

To truly understand the effectiveness of these modifications, measuring actual power gains is essential. Here are some methods to consider when evaluating performance improvements.

Dyno Testing

One of the most accurate ways to measure power gains is through dyno testing. This method provides a clear picture of how much horsepower and torque your vehicle produces before and after modifications.

Real-World Performance Testing

In addition to dyno testing, real-world performance testing can help gauge improvements. This can include measuring acceleration times and observing changes in driving dynamics.
